CVE-2023-20110 is a SQL injection v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co Smart Software Manager On-Prem. This flaw allows an authenticated, low-privileged remote attacker to execute crafted SQL queries due to inadequate user input validation.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 6.5 (Medium), indicating it can lead to the disclosure of sensitive data from the underlying database.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
